Welcome to The Night Circus Soiree! The party is our ode to the amazing fantasy novel The Night Circus by Erin Morgenstern* The Night Circus features Celia and Marco, young magicians destined for a duel to the death that they had no part in, but they turned the tables on their magician teachers and ended up falling in love…at The Night Circus. Step into our twist on the magical black-and-white striped circus and prepare to be entertained.

THE CIRCUS TENTS
We’ve brought to life many different circus tents throughout the venue for you to experience
The Ice Garden
A magical interior garden made entirely from ice. It is Marco’s creation and Celia's favorite attraction. This tent features a small bar serving only the signature drink, “The Ice Garden"—a glass of bubbly served with a piece of blue rock candy!
The Reflection Tent
A beautiful, sparkly tent made entirely from reflective balloons and other materials. Great selfie spot!
Creatures of Mist and Paper
This tent features the paper-cutting artist, Lauren Iida. Watch her intricately cut a 5-foot+++ long paper “net” that incorporates imagery from The Night Circus. **HER ART IS FOR SALE! Place your bid on her creation on the piece of paper displayed at her tent.
The Hall of Mirrors
Just what its name implies.
The Drawing Room
A tent surrounded by blackboards and buckets of chalk provided for guests to draw. The drawings come to life in the book after people have drawn them.
The Stargazer
In the book, this tent is a slow roller-coaster-styled ride at an upward angle, allowing visitors to look up at the stars. It is one of the few items in the circus explicitly described as purely mundane. HOWEVER, we’ve made it much more interesting by incorporating a VR headset experience into the tent.
The Pavilion of Memories
A tent of jars, each containing a scent invoking memories of past idyllic scenes. OPEN THE JARS AND TAKE A SNIFF! In the book, the jars hold memories, and sniffing brings them back to life for you.
Pool of Tears
A silent pool of water surrounded by white stones. You’ll see a box filled with polished black stones at the entrance. As you enter the tent, take one with you and throw it into the pool. This signifies throwing away your worries…and lightening your load.

The Wishing Tree
A tree where circus guests can write wishes on candles and light them from previous wishes (candles). Enjoy our twist on this important feature of the book.
Fortune Tellers Tent
Have your future told…if you dare!
The Central Cauldron
It contains a white, constantly burning fire. This is also the source of the spell that binds Celia and Marco to the circus.

The Rêveurs Lounge: Rêveurs" are members of the unofficial fan club for The Night Circus. They are extremely devoted to all aspects of the circus, and many follow it around the world. They all wear a splash of red to the circus so they can spot each other and mingle. This beautifully decorated lounge is sponsored by Defrost Dates, a social club. This is where you go to mix and mingle with other guests; perhaps find Celia or Marco and have fun. This lounge area is open to everyone.
